Andrew Hartzler Mrs. Andrea Gillespie English III 28 October 2015 What makes a poem intriguing? Writers have always developed new ways to make their own works of art more enticing to the reader, or audience member. One method is figurative language. Figurative language allows the writer to express his or her meaning in a deeper way. It allows the writer to effectively get their point across by giving the reader a mental picture or visual. One writer who conveys figurative language all throughout his plays is William Shakespeare. Although Shakespeare has hundred of playwrights, one in particular is Macbeth. Throughout Macbeth there are hundreds of different uses of figurative language, used to convey different themes. One theme in particular is natural vs. unnatural. The play Macbeth shows continuous examples of the theme natural vs. unnatural, which depicts the disruptions to the natural world. Throughout the entire play there are examples of unnatural occurrences and themes, one encounter occurs at the start of the play during an i ntense thunderstorm. The three witches are in the beginning stages of creating their plot against Macbeth, the witches are deciding when to meet again to device a scheme against Macbeth. The witches say, ââ¬Å"When shall we three meet again In thunder, lightning, or in rain? When the hurlyburly s done, When the battle s lost and won.â⬠(1.1.1-4). The volunteering that was required for this class was completed in four different locations. Three of these locations did have a connection to my education. The first was at an elementary school. The volunteering position was for a pre-kindergarten teacher aide. The second position was for a kindergarten AWANAââ¬â¢s class. The last position was babysitting a nine-month girl. All three locations and volunteer jobs were connected to my education, because I was working with children and my degree is in Early Childhood Education. The first location, the school, I did the job of a teacher aide. The aideââ¬â¢s job was simple and rewarding. The first job that that needed to be completed was pulling the chairs off the tables. The next job began as the students arrived; I checked backpacks for folders and library books. After that, I returned the library books, stuffed papers into their folders, and return them to their backpacks. After the folders were put away I began to prepper for a ladybug painting activity. Students came to my station one at a time until the entire class was completed one red body and six black legs. The end of the day I was able to monitor the class on the playground and walk them to the bus. The second location, AWANAââ¬â¢s, was at my church and I was an educator in the kindergarten sparks program. The responsibilities I had each week was to monitor the children, teach Bible verses, sign off after they memorized them, and walked them to the gym and weekly lesson.
